As @Kenpachi1985 mentioned, the CPU isn't ideal for gaming. You can add a graphics card and play games, but the CPU will limit your performance. It's not worth installing a strong GPU to prevent bottlenecks, so I'd stick with a GTX 1050 or 1050Ti. While this lets you run some titles, depending on your motherboard, you might get a Ryzen 5 1600 if you're budget-conscious, or a Ryzen 3600 if your board supports it better. A more powerful CPU enables a better GPU, letting you play more games at higher framerates. My recommendation is to upgrade both CPU and GPU unless you're extremely on a tight budget—long-term value matters more.
